Abstract
The European Higher Education Area (EHEA) was constituted in Paris in 1998. It was a result of the need for the establishment of a common Higher Education for all the countries of the European Union. Furthermore, the Declaration of Bologna which was signed in 1999 defined the necessary actions for European Universities to adapt to the EHEA. In Greece the first step was put into action in 2005 with the law for the quality assurance at HEIs (3374/2005). Next steps towards the harmonizing of Greek HEIs with the EHEA were the law 4009/2011 and the recently adopted Hellenic Qualifications Framework (2014). This article aims to analyze the issues surrounding the quality assurance of Higher Education in the Informatics and Telecommunications field in Greece.
